TSMC's material-transition opening is the fab itself: ultrapure water, specialty chemicals, gases, wafers and process recovery at a scale where a small yield improvement becomes a physical-economy decision. Its 2025 reporting says waste isopropanol was reprocessed into electronic-grade products. That is a real qualification lane. The first useful unit is one fab, one process family, and one closed-loop chemical specification.

TSMC's 2025 sustainability reporting identifies water positive, net zero emissions and nature commitments, and describes a cross-regional reclaimed-water exchange model, reprocessing isopropanol waste liquid into electronic-grade products, and adoption of blue ammonia for critical chemicals. TSMC's 2025 annual report states 15.0 million 12-inch-equivalent wafer shipments and more than 17 million of annual capacity. Public sources do not establish one fab-level mass balance for water, chemicals, gases, wafer scrap and recovered-input allocation.

Material inputs to resolve

  • Silicon wafers, photoresists, specialty gases, solvents, acids, bases, metals and packaging inputs
  • Ultrapure water, electricity, natural gas and cleanroom consumables
  • Spent chemicals, wastewater, wafer scrap and returned process materials available for qualified recovery

Outputs and residuals to resolve

  • Advanced logic and specialty semiconductors, wafers, packages and process services
  • Wastewater, spent chemicals, wafer scrap, gases and cleanroom waste
  • Fab-level recovery yield, supplier allocation and customer product accounting remain open
First decision: Choose one fab and one process family. Map water, chemical, gas, wafer and packaging inputs to recovery, reuse, qualification and product evidence.
